  Jeff Brohm's Louisville football homecoming will feature a quarterback reunion. Jack Plummer, the starting QB at Cal this past season, announced Wednesday on social media he's transferring to Louisville. The 6-foot-5, 215-pound Plummer played 21 games in three seasons for Brohm at Purdue before transferring to Cal. He's a graduate transfer with one season of eligibility remaining. Brohm left the Boilermakers this month to return to his alma mater as head coach.

Plummer is coming off his best collegiate season, throwing for 3,095 yards with 21 touchdowns and nine interceptions for the Bears in 2022. His best season at Purdue was his first as a starter. After redshirting in 2018, Plummer played seven games for the Boilermakers in 2019, throwing for 1,603 yards, 11 touchdowns and eight interceptions. In his Purdue career, Plummer threw for 3,404 yards with 26 TDs and 10 picks. Plummer, who played at Gilbert (Arizona) High School, was a three-star prospect in the class of 2018 according to 247Sports.com's composite rating, which ranked him the No. 556 player and No. 22 pro-style QB in the class. - Courier Journal

  Jack Plummer threw three touchdown passes in his debut for California and Craig Woodson returned an interception for a score to lead California to a 34-13 victory over UC Davis on Saturday. The Golden Bears (1-0) shook off a rough start on offense with minus-1 yard in the first quarter to improve to 11-0 all-time against the Aggies (0-1). Plummer threw TD passes of 3 yards to Jeremiah Hunter and 8 yards Jaydn Ott in the second quarter, and a 14-yarder to Mavin Anderson in the fourth quarter of his first appearance since transferring from Purdue.

Woodson helped take control of the game when he intercepted Miles Hastings on the opening drive of the second half and returned it 39 yards for a touchdown that made it 24-7. Plummer finished 23 for 35 for 268 yards. Ott ran for 104 yards to go along with his TD catch. Hastings threw a 4-yard touchdown pass to Chaz Davis in the first quarter Ulonzo Gilliam Jr. scored on a 60-yard run in the third quarter for the Aggies. Hastings finished 32 for 50 for 242 yards with two interceptions. - California/AP College Football

  One of three key transfer portal additions in the offseason, 6-5/215 redshirt junior quarterback Jack Plummer finds himself in a strong position in his battle to take over as starting QB for departed 4-year starter Chase Garbers at Cal. The fifth-year QB from Gilbert, Arizona earned honorable mention All-USA Arizona honors as a 2017 senior, completing 195-of-335 passes (58.2%) for 2861 yards and 35 touchdowns with seven interceptions, while also rushing for 404 yards and eight additional touchdowns. "Out of high school, my top two were Purdue and South Carolina," said Plummer. "The Purdue connection started from my defensive coordinator in high school who played at Louisville with the Brohm's (former Louisville and current head coach and OC Jeff and Brian Brohm). He slid them my film and they were recruiting me the hardest. I thought it was a good fit playing for a head coach and offensive coordinator who both played quarterback in the NFL." Plummer started 13 games in his time at Purdue, completing 319-of-492 passes (64.8%) for 3405 yards with 26 touchdowns and 10 interceptions for a 136.35 quarterback rating. - Bearinsider.com

  As Jeff Brohm looks to push Purdue's program forward after back-to-back losing seasons, he'll begin this important year with a starting quarterback who can add mobility while leaning on his experience. Jack Plummer features both and has earned the starting job for the Sept. 4 season-opener when the Boilermakers host Oregon State at Ross-Ade Stadium. Plummer won a close competition with Aidan O'Connell, last year's opening-day starter, and Austin Burton, a transfer from UCLA prior to last season but has yet to play. Just the threat of a running quarterback should help expand Brohm's offense to a different level. With struggles in the running game the last two seasons, the Boilermakers need a threat on the ground, even if it comes from the quarterback position.

The mobility of Plummer, along with Burton, has always been appealing to Brohm. The option of having a dual-threat at quarterback opens up Brohm's playbook and gives the offense an opportunity to keep defenses off-balanced and produce more big plays. Plummer will be asked to use his legs more in key situations - third down plays and in the red zone. "We think the quarterback position has to have that threat with the ball in his hands and the defense has to honor him and respect him," Brohm said. "It's something we always have to have in the game plan. "We feel like it has to be an option and we have to utilize it. Taking care of the football when that's being done and protecting yourself when you do run and get yards and get positive plays and get down when you have to. If the down and distance require you to go get the first down, that's what you have to do." - Journal and Courier

  Jack Plummer threw for 420 yards and three touchdowns and Cory Trice returned an interception for a score to break open the game just before halftime, helping Purdue roll past Maryland 40-14. The Boilermakers (2-4, 1-2 Big Ten) snapped a three-game losing streak with their most lopsided win since upsetting No. 2 Ohio State last October. Maryland (3-3, 1-2) still hasn't won consecutive conference road games since 2014 and never had a chance after Trice picked off Tyrrell Pigrome and scored on a 37-yard interception return with 18 seconds left in the first half to make it 30-14.

Plummer was 33 of 41, hooking up with David Bell nine times for 138 yards and two touchdowns. Brycen Hopkins caught 10 passes for 140 yards, both career bests. And all that came after coach Jeff Brohm inserted three new starters on the offensive line — Mark Stickford at left guard, Sam Garvin at center and Eric Miller at right tackle. It couldn't have worked out better. King Doerue was effective on the ground and Plummer took advantage of his protection right from the start. Purdue scored on its first two possessions as Plummer found Bell for a 23-yard TD pass and Doerue scored on a 4-yard touchdown run to make it 13-0. - Purdue/AP College Football
